The radioactive iodine will then be more likely to destroy thyroid cells. The general recommendation is to follow this diet for 1-2 weeks before radiation treatment, as well as 1-2 days after radiation. Check with your medical provider to see how long you should follow the diet. The low iodine diet
WebThe Low-Iodine Diet (LID) is a short-term diet that most doctors recommend to help papillary and follicular thyroid cancer patients become “iodine hungry” prior to scanning or treatment with radioactive iodine. Your doctor may ask you to follow a Low Iodine Diet for two to four weeks before a radioactive iodine … effie brown linkedinWeb13 apr. 2024 · Low iodine diet; Radioactive iodine; Thyroid replacement medication; Childbearing and thyroid cancer; Long-term survivors; Mental challenges of living with thyroid cancer; Young adults and thyroid cancer; Family members and caregivers; In memoriam: Love, loss, and legacy; ThyCa fundraising and thyroid cancer research grants contents of class 9 mathsWebThe thyroid uses iodine from the diet to make thyroid hormone and is one of the few organs that will take up iodine. Radioactive iodine (RAI) is a radioactive form of iodine that can be used to either scan or ablate (i.e. destroy) thyroid cells. Radioactive iodine has been used safely in medicine since the 1920's.
